Raised Air Beds
You have guests coming to your home for an overnight stay, and no extra bed for them to sleep on.
Why not look into raised air beds as a solution for your problem?
A raised air bed is much like a traditional air mattress, but inflates to the height of a standard traditional bed, providing your guests with the comfort they need for a good night's sleep.
Available in sizes much like traditional mattresses, raised air beds give you all of the comforts of a traditional bed in an easily portable, inflatable mattress.
Most raised air beds come with a built-in pump, in order to help make inflating the bed as easy as possible.
Many also allow for the firmness of the top portion of the mattress to be adjusted, giving your guests control of their comfort.
Just like with traditional mattresses, raised air beds come in various forms.
There are fabric-topped raised air beds, and pillowtop raised air beds.
And no matter what size bed you have, fitted and standard sheets will fit them.
Raised air beds inflate and deflate quickly, which will give you ease of use and makes them easy to transport.
Just imagine being able to take the comfort of your bed at home on vacation, no matter where your travels may take you.
Raised air beds take air mattresses to a brand new level of comfort for temporary sleep situations.
It seems that the days of those vinyl-coated mattresses often used for camping are long over.
With raised air beds, you get all the comfort of a traditional coil-spring mattress bed in an easy-to-use, easy-to-transport inflatable version.

South American Skiing: Ski Portillo Receives Four Feet in Four Days
Portillo, Chile (ContentDesk) July 13, 2006 -- Ski Portillo, the legendary Chilean resort, has received four feet of snow in four days, and the snow continues to fall on its South American slopes. Portillo receives nearly 300 days of sunshine and an average of 25 feet of snowfall each season, with last years snow totaling a record 46 feet. New this year is an additional Va et Vient ("Coming and Going") slingshot lift named Las Vizcachas, which accesses expert-only terrain in the Las Lomas ski area. The new slingshot lift is named after the local Vizcacha rabbit and is 470 meters/1542 feet long with a vertical drop of 220 meters/722 feet.The 2006 summer season is underway and runs through Oct. 7, 2006.
